Frequently asked questions about holiday rentals in Ko Lanta

  • What are the must-see sights in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    Ko Lanta offers a range of attractions. For stunning beaches, head to Long Beach, Klong Dao Beach, or Phra Ae Beach. Mu Ko Lanta National Park is a must-visit for its diverse marine life and jungle trails, leading to hidden bays and viewpoints like Koh Rok and Koh Haa. Lanta Old Town, with its charming Sino-Portuguese architecture, offers a glimpse into the island's history. Don't miss the Lanta Animal Welfare, a sanctuary for rescued animals.

  • Are there any unique natural phenomena in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    Ko Lanta's natural beauty is its main draw. The diverse coral reefs surrounding the islands are teeming with marine life, perfect for snorkelling and diving. The limestone karsts and hidden lagoons within Mu Ko Lanta National Park create unique landscapes. The sunsets over the Andaman Sea are also a daily spectacle.

  • What essentials should you bring along for a trip to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    Pack light, breathable clothing suitable for hot and humid weather. Don't forget swimwear, sunscreen (high SPF is crucial), insect repellent, a hat, sunglasses, and comfortable walking shoes for exploring. A reusable water bottle is essential, and a waterproof bag is handy for beach trips. Consider a sarong for temple visits.

  • What famous events or festivals are happening in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    Ko Lanta doesn't have large-scale international festivals. However, local events and celebrations may occur throughout the year, often linked to Buddhist holidays such as Songkran (Thai New Year) which is celebrated nationally. Check local listings closer to your travel dates for smaller, community-based events.

  • What is the average daily budget you should plan for (accommodation, food, transportation, activities) in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    A daily budget in Ko Lanta can vary greatly depending on your choices. Budget travellers could manage on around 1500 THB (£35-£40 GBP) per day, covering basic accommodation, local food, motorbike hire, and some activities. Mid-range travellers might spend 3000-4000 THB (£70-£90 GBP), while luxury travellers could easily spend significantly more.

  • Where can you find the best restaurants serving local dishes in Ko Lanta, Thailand, and what are the must-try specialties?

    Ko Lanta offers numerous restaurants. For authentic Thai cuisine, try restaurants in Lanta Old Town, such as the many smaller family-run establishments. Look for dishes like Gaeng Som (sour curry), Massaman Curry, and Pad Thai. Fresh seafood is abundant; try it at restaurants along the beaches. Many restaurants offer a variety of international options too.
  • What are some less-famous attractions in Ko Lanta, Thailand that are worth a visit?

    Beyond the popular beaches, explore the quieter Klong Khong Beach or explore the mangrove forests by kayak. Visit the small local markets for a taste of daily life. Consider a boat trip to the less-visited islands near Ko Lanta, offering a more secluded experience.
  • What are the best activities for engaging with locals and understanding their culture in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    Visit local markets to interact with vendors and experience the daily rhythm of life. Attend a Thai cooking class to learn about local ingredients and culinary traditions. Take a boat trip with a local operator, engaging in conversation. Simply chatting with people in local restaurants and shops can also offer insights into the local culture.
  • What unique natural landscapes and terrain features can travellers explore in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    Ko Lanta's landscape is a blend of sandy beaches, lush jungle, and limestone karsts. Mu Ko Lanta National Park offers opportunities to hike through jungle trails, explore hidden lagoons, and discover stunning viewpoints overlooking the Andaman Sea. The mangrove forests offer a unique ecosystem to explore by kayak.
  • How many days are ideal for visiting Ko Lanta, Thailand, and what are some itinerary suggestions?

    Three to five days allows for a good balance of relaxation and exploration. A possible itinerary could include: Day 1: Beach relaxation and exploring Lanta Old Town. Day 2: Mu Ko Lanta National Park boat trip. Day 3: Kayaking in the mangroves and visiting a local market. Extend your stay to include island hopping or diving/snorkelling trips.
